		<description>Wisdom??  Well at least let me share some stories.
First:  Randy Smith.   My friend was teammates with him in soccer.  He told me that one day in practice Smith beat the entire team in a 40 yard dash.  Soooo?  Smith ran it BACKWARDS!
And Wally, thanks for the name Ernie DiGregorio.  Just a memory from long ago.  Back in the &#039;60s the NY Capital District (Albany area) ran a post-season boys BB tourney.  Four all-star teams played, Capital District, WNY, Western PA, and New England. The year I went to watch, Ernie D was on the NE team.  It was amazing how he dominated the tournament.  What was he? 6&quot;0, 6&quot;1?  But he was &quot;head and shoulders above all other players&quot;.  WNY had an almost-7 footer named Bill Smith (Henrietta) and Ernie just  dwarfed hin and everyone else.  Since it was the &quot;best of the best&quot;, I was clearly impressed.  I don&#039;t think Ernie was the &quot;athlete&quot; that Randy Smith was, but on that court on that day he was a giant!</description>

		<description>YESSSSSSSSSSSSSSSS!!!!!!!!!!!!!!

Randy Smith it is. Smith played college ball at D3 Buffalo State and established the consecutive game streak when played 906 in a row. A,C. Green broke the record in 1997.</description>
